Bioanalytical LC-MS method development for quantitative determination of drugs and their metabolites in biological fluids is crucial during drug development. The need for efficiently generated, regulatory compliant bioanalytical data is reliant on fit-for-purpose methods being developed and validated by experienced LC-MS scientists.

LC-MS method development expertise includes:

  • Liquid/Liquid, SPE and Protein Precipitation in 96-Well and Standard Formats
  • Hydrophilic Interaction Chromatography (HILIC)
  • Ion Exchange Solid Phase Extraction (SPE) and Chromatography
  • Chiral Analysis
  • Analysis of Drugs in Ocular Tissues
  • Analysis of Peptides and Pegylated Drugs and Metabolites
  • High Throughput Automated Liquid handling Using Hamilton Microlab StarLET Systems
